Redirection is one of the terms associated with website which is the process of forwarding URL to a different URL. There are mainly three types of redirects available which include 301, 302 and Meta refresh. The 301 is a redirect which is moved permanently and is best one recommended for the SEO, the 302 is the found or moved temporarily redirects. The redirect is a process of sending both the search engines and users to a different URL and not letting them to go to the originally requested site.

Redirect of a page is done for many reasons which includes , when URL of site is broken or it do not work properly, if webpage / site is no longer active or it has any trouble, you have created a new website and you want your visitors to visit new site instead of old site. If your site is undergoing any kind of testing or if you are testing a webpage for which you want to temporarily make a detour for visitors for continual website experience. 302 Redirect- a Common Redirect Used in SEO

The 302 redirect is one of the common way of URL redirection which is also called as temporary redirect and a successor of 301 redirect. This is mainly done in order to redirect visitors who are visiting your site into another webpage and you can bring the redirected page after sometime. The 302 redirect will not pass all qualities of the original page to redirected page. The page rank, page authority, mozrank, traffic value everything is still maintained by redirected page and there is no chance of accumulating these factors by detour page. The redirection is mostly done when there is a change in design of website, coding, updating and navigation of website etc. 302 redirect is mostly used by seo specialists when they want to test a new page which is for getting client feedback but they do not want to change or damage the old page history or rankings. By using the 302 redirect it is safe to retain page rank in original site as it does not pass any page rank or the link value to the new location or the redirected page. This is mainly used as a diversion to a new location for protecting visitors from the broken links and the 404 errors. This is a redirect which is commonly used by e-commerce sites as the seller will have the products that are seasonal in nature. This is mainly for putting website in maintenance mode and for doing the updating. This can direct visitors to similar products of interest hut they cannot place the order in the new page redirected. This redirect is used when requested content in search engine is temporarily offline, when original page becomes available then the page rank can be restored.

301 and 302 Redirects and Its Differences

There is only a subtle difference between 301 and 302 redirect and they are not interchangeable, if you choose to do mistake by choosing 302 redirect instead of 301 then whole seo juice will be a great loss. Redirection is one of the important factors done in seo and it is very important to observe best practices to maintain the seo value. Sometimes redirects can hurt your website and even the seo efforts of the website. when you do redirection for your page it may cause the pages to load slower because, this is mainly because it is a waste of time to go to one place and then just getting redirected to another page. When 302 redirect is done to the page, there will be more and more visitors who will be getting redirected to page and many of them use this in the mobile devices causing more problem. The websites which has implemented mobile seo solution recently should pay close attention to page redirection. The 302 redirects mainly affect users who use this in the mobile devices as they uses the less reliable mobile networks than the desktop users. The redirects mainly cause significant performance and the speed issues in loading of your website.

It is better to avoid redirects and if you do not use the redirect then you are serving the content of your website even faster. If you have a redirection code in your website then it is a great waster in your code, especially for the mobile device. The 302 is one of server side redirects which are fast and cacheable, in this redirect the server is using HTTP to direct the browser to a new location. You can check for the redirects in your page by using the seo tools which helps to detects and displays the 301 and 302 redirects. It is important to check redirects in your site and to change them because it can lead to slowing down of your pages. Removing the redirects is important, you have to find the redirect, understand why redirect exist in your site, check to see how it affects other redirects, remove it if it is not needed, update it if it affects other redirects.
